Note: Underbalanced (trailing edge heavy) conditions are corrected by adding
additional weight to the control surface. Typically, by placing additional
washers, lead or steel, under each nut or bolt head retaining the balance
mass, as required. A maximum of four washers per bolt and nut retaining
the balance masses and a maximum of three washers under any bolt head
or nut. Always place steel washer next to nut.
Overbalance (leading edge heavy) conditions are corrected by removing
small amounts of material from the lead balance mass, typically by drilling
or other means. Correction may also be accomplished by reducing the num-
ber of washers, used in retention of the mass balance. Observe all health
precautions when handling lead.
